Understanding Bespoke Conservatories
Bespoke conservatories are custom-made structures developed to satisfy the specific desires and requirements of house owners. They can serve various functions, including a sun parlor, office, or an extra home. The crucial features of bespoke conservatories consist of:
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Custom Design | Tailored to fit your home's design and your individual taste |
| Quality Materials | Built from resilient materials, guaranteeing longevity |
| Energy Efficiency | Developed to provide insulation and minimize energy costs |
| Versatile Functionality | Can be utilized for different purposes based upon homeowner requires |

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Bespoke Conservatory Installer
Picking the right installer can be frustrating, offered the sheer variety of options offered. Here are some factors to assist limit your choices:
1. Experience and Reputation
Think about the installer's experience in the market. Are they established and acknowledged for their work? Evaluations and testimonials can use key insights into their efficiency.
2. Portfolio of Past Work
An experienced installer needs to be prepared to display previous installations. Evaluating their portfolio will assist you evaluate their design abilities and craftsmanship.
3. Customer support
The installation procedure must be a collaborative experience. Select an installer that communicates clearly, listens to your requirements, and provides ongoing assistance throughout the project.
4. Licensing and Insurance
Confirm that the installer holds the essential licenses, permits, and insurance coverage. This is a crucial protect to protect you from potential liabilities during installation.
5. Service warranty and Aftercare
Inquire about guarantees on setups and products used. A great installer will use a comprehensive aftercare plan to resolve any potential problems post-installation.
The Process of Installing a Bespoke Conservatory
Comprehending the installation procedure can help you get ready for what's to come:
1. Preliminary Consultation
Homeowners consult with the installer to discuss concepts, choices, and the intended use of the conservatory. This is a chance to share vision and check out design possibilities.
2. Site Survey
The installer will carry out an extensive site survey to assess the area, ensuring the design fits well within the existing environment.
3. Design and Planning
Based on the assessment and site study, the installer will create a detailed design strategy, that includes sketches and material specifications.
4. Approval and Permits
When the design is settled, the installer will assist with any needed permits or approvals from local authorities.
5. Construction
The construction stage follows, where the conservatory is built according to the agreed-upon requirements. This includes laying foundations, building the frame, and installing roof and glazing.
6. Final Inspection
After construction is total, a final evaluation guarantees everything has been done to the highest standard, and any complements are applied.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the average expense of a bespoke conservatory?
The cost can differ widely based upon size, products, and design complexity. Usually, prices can vary from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more.
How long does it take to build a bespoke conservatory?
Usually, the installation process can take anywhere from a couple of weeks to a number of months, depending on the intricacy of the design and climate condition.
Are bespoke conservatories energy-efficient?
Yes, modern bespoke conservatories can be created with energy-efficient materials and innovations to help in reducing cooling and heating expenses.
Do I need planning consent for a conservatory?
In a lot of cases, you will not need preparing authorization for a conservatory if it fulfills specific criteria. Nevertheless, it's always best to speak with your installer about your local guidelines.
Can I use a bespoke conservatory year-round?
Yes, bespoke conservatories can be developed for year-round use with sufficient insulation, heating, and cooling alternatives.
